Foden Wins FWA Men’s Player of the Year Award

Phil Foden, a star midfielder for Manchester City, has been named the Football Writers’ Association’s Footballer of the Year for the 2023/24 season. He secured a dominant victory, receiving 42% of the votes cast by FWA members.

This continues Manchester City’s dominance in the award, with Foden becoming the third City player to win in four years, following Ruben Dias (2021) and Erling Haaland (2023).

Foden edged out Arsenal’s Declan Rice and teammate Rodri, who finished second and third, respectively. Other contenders included Martin Odegaard, Ollie Watkins, and Manchester City youngster Cole Palmer.

The 23-year-old playmaker has been in phenomenal form this season, contributing a staggering 16 goals and 7 assists in the Premier League alone. He’s also impressed in the Champions League with 5 goals and 3 assists, adding another 2 goals in the FA Cup.
